DISC 1: The true glory: a documentary account of the Allied invasions in Europe during WWII. Compiled from the footage shot by nearly 1400 cameramen, it opens as the assembled allied forces plan and train for the D-Day invasion, then covers all the major events of the war to the fall of Berlin. With an introduction by Dwight D. Eisenhower.
August 1942: depicts the first raid on the French coast, two years before D-Day.
